BASF now offers high performance Ultramid® (polyamide), which is derived from renewable raw materials. BASF uses an innovative approach that replaces up to 100% of the fossil resources used at the beginning of the integrated production process with certified biomass.
BASF will introduce its innovative LNT+CS4F™ emissions control system for diesel engines at the International Vienna Motor Symposium, being held May 8 to 9, 2014, in Vienna, Austria. The new system combines the features of a Lean NOx Trap (LNT) and a multifunctional catalyzed soot filter (CS4F).

Axalta Coating Systems, a leading global supplier of liquid and powder coatings, was granted the Outstanding Environmental Technology Award at the 2014 China Surface Engineering Summit (CSES) in Shanghai, China. The technology recognized for its contribution to environmental sustainability is Axalta’s Lean and Green Coating System. The award recognizes Axalta’s leadership in developing surface treatment solutions that meet industry’s evolving demands for high performance and sustainable coatings.

Scarce and expensive raw materials, rising energy prices, climate protection and demographic shifts leave industrial production with a lot to contend with in the coming years. In the “ E3-production” lighthouse project, Fraunhofer researchers are laying the groundwork needed to achieve sustainable production. They will be at the Hannover Messe from April 7-11 to showcase the first project solutions (Hall 2 and Hall 17).
